A lack of organic-certified cream and of organic-certified pasture-raised milk and the presence of antibiotics, genetic modification, synthetic hormones and toxic pesticides explain when Half & Half is not referred to as organic. Organic certification in the United States results from documenting and following guidelines and from passing regular inspections. Adherence to proper procedure and incorporation of proper local, non-chemical, non-genetically modified, non-synthetic, on-site inputs and resources will allow the Half & Half in question to be labeled USDA organic in the United States.
